Kim Jong-kook says his wedding will be a private event
In a handwritten letter to fans, as reported by ChosunBiz EN, Kim Jong-kook wrote, “I’m getting married” and explained, “This year marks my 30th anniversary since debut, and while I haven’t made the album I wanted, I’ve created my other half.” He added, “Still, I hope you will congratulate me and support me. It’s very late, but how fortunate it is to go this way. I will strive to live well.”
Kim Jong-kook did not reveal details about his fiancée. He stated, “I plan to hold the wedding quietly with family, relatives, and a few acquaintances, on a scale that is not very large, as soon as possible.” A source from his agency, TURBO.JK COMPANY commented, “It’s even more meaningful to make this new start in the significant year of his 30th debut anniversary. It would be great if many people could send warm support and congratulate him.” (via Soompi)
Kim Jong-kook debuted in 1995 with the group Turbo, rising to fame with “Remind,” “White Love,” and “Twist King.” He began his solo career in 2001 with hits like “One Man,” “Staying in Place,” and “Lovely.” His third solo album, featuring “Lovely,” won multiple year-end broadcasting awards in 2005. He also built a strong television career through X-Man, Family Outing, Running Man, and My Little Old Boy. In 2020, he received the SBS Entertainment Awards grand prize for his variety show success.
